Location address


You can obviously also reach the eatery using the public transport. The next stop is Greyhound-San Antonio, 669 meters away from Zio's Italian Kitchen, Alternatively, you can also drive your car to the 163 meters away M & S Tower Parking and park there. The nearest parking lot is Park and is 157 m away from Zio's Italian Kitchen.

Map

More restaurants near Zio's Italian Kitchen

These restaurants are in the vicinity of 18030 San Pedro Avenue, San Antonio, 78205, United States Of America.

4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: San Antonio, 7720 Jones Maltsberger Concord PlazaTX 78216, San Antonio, United States
"The happy hour food, drinks, service ambience is always wonderful"
4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: San Antonio, 5221 Walzem Rd Suite 1, San Antonio, USA, United States
"Loved it! I will be taking my grandchildren again."
4.9
Menu
Open Now
4.9
Menu
Open Now
City: San Antonio, 7007 Bandera Rd Suite 14, San Antonio I-78238-1265, United States
"Great place, great food. Food: 5 Service: 5 Atmosphere: 5"
4.9
Menu
Table booking
Open Now
4.9
Menu
Table booking
Open Now
City: San Antonio, 227 4th St, San Antonio I-78205, United States
"Carl w/ a c is the only way to b Food: 5 Service: 5 Atmosphere: 5"
4.8
Menu
Table booking
Open Now
4.8
Menu
Table booking
Open Now
City: San Andreas (near San Antonio), 5815 Rim Pass DriveTX 78257, 78257-4502, San Andreas, United States
"Mia was awesome! Very attentive and professional."
4.3
Menu
Table booking
Open Now
4.3
Menu
Table booking
Open Now
City: San Antonio, 7350 Tezel Rd #108, 78250, San Antonio, US, United States
"I went for the first time just last night, right before closing. Their signs outside are broken so it may look closed however they are open every night until 2! The atmosphere was chill and relaxed and everyone minded their own. The bartenders were kind and welcoming and delivered great service. Recommended for a night out if you're in the area"
4.4
Menu
Table booking
Open Now
4.4
Menu
Table booking
Open Now
City: San Antonio, 3928 Broadway, 78209, San Antonio, US, United States
"One of my daughter's favorite places to eat.."
4.4
Menu
Table booking
Open Now
4.4
Menu
Table booking
Open Now
City: San Antonio, 4727 Medical Dr Ste 102, 78229, San Antonio, US, United States
"I love chipotle , they have great healthy choices."
4.3
Menu
Open Now
4.3
Menu
Open Now
City: San Antonio, 5526 Evers Rd, 78238, San Antonio, US, United States
"Food: 5 Service: 5 Atmosphere: 4"
4.3
Menu
Table booking
Open Now
4.3
Menu
Table booking
Open Now
City: San Antonio, 200 W Jones Ave #501, 78205, San Antonio, US, United States
"Wonderful experience! delicious food and exceptional service."